"My job has the fundamentals of an accountancy role. I'm a qualified accountant, but I've gone beyond that to explore the bigger retail picture. We look at energy prices, what other retail businesses in our sector are doing and at the volume we're supplying to people within the different regions. It's a very complex business area; it takes a lot of variables and pulls them all together."

Current challenges - work that matters. "The model I'm working on right now explores total retail, all the way from customer numbers and profitability, to operating costs, and the bottom line EBIT. It uses information from all around the business, all the different areas of the business, and pulls it together so that we can examine it through different perspectives. Do we think the customer numbers are going to go up or down? Do we think that usage is going to go down? And, green issues connected to climate change and energy consumption also come to the fore. We log all those numbers in, and look at different scenarios that give us a final profit figure."

Personal challenges. "I have to be able to understand quickly what's happening within the whole of the business. It can be very creative as well, in that I have to find ways around different problems. There's also plenty of opportunity on offer. I can work elsewhere in UK and in Germany as well. And, with so much change in the industry, innovation is a part of everything we do."
